South Korea's Online Shopping Hits $17.4B Record in March, Mobile Sales Lead
NewsMay 4, 2026

South Korea's Online Shopping Hits $17.4B Record in March, Mobile Sales Lead

South Korea's online retail volume reached a new high in March, climbing 13.3% year‑over‑year to 25.58 trillion won (about $17.4 billion). Mobile commerce drove the surge, contributing 75.9% of total online sales and growing 11.6% to 19.41 trillion won ($13.2 billion). Strong demand for...

KFC Has A Different Name In Quebec. Here's Why
NewsMay 4, 2026

KFC Has A Different Name In Quebec. Here's Why

KFC operates in Quebec under the French name PFK (Poulet Frit Kentucky) due to the 1977 Charter of the French Language, which requires commercial names to be in French. The chain adopted the French branding early, avoiding later legal disputes...
